As you know Jaxon was born at 27 weeks weighing 1lb 11oz. He was very poorly and faced many problems such as requiring ventilation/oxygen, an haemorrhage in his lungs, MRSA, had 7 blood transfusions and jaundice, he was hospitalised for 11 weeks in the neo- natal unit. but now a very healthy 7 year old. The doctors and nurses do an amazing job.
My great niece Gracie was also born prematurely at 34 weeks weighing 4lb 10oz and also had problems. She is now a healthy 5 month old.

I’ve chosen to fundraise for Bliss because I want to make a real difference to the 95,000 babies born premature or sick every year. Every donation that’s made to this page brings Bliss closer to ensuring that every baby born premature or sick in the UK has the best chance of survival and quality of life. Bliss does that by supporting parents to care for their babies, campaigning for better neonatal care and enabling life-changing research.
